My cat's back legs are shaking. Should I be worried or see a vet?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Cat | Mixed Breed | Male | unneutered

My cats back legs are shaking and I don't know what's causing it.

It could be Shaky is in pain, either from his back or hips. Rest him tonight, keep him indoors if he's allowed outside, and watch him. If he's still acting this way in the morning, have him seen by a vet. Do not give him any human pain medications. Many are toxic to cats, and are fatal if given. Best of luck.
